首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 31 毫秒
1.
An R2 indicator-based multi-objective particle swarm optimiser (R2-MOPSO) can obtain well-convergence and well-distributed solutions while solving two and three objectives optimisation problems. However, R2-MOPSO faces difficulty to tackle many-objective optimisation problems because balancing convergence and diversity is a key issue in high-dimensional objective space. In order to address this issue, this paper proposes a novel algorithm, named R2-MaPSO, which combines the R2 indicator and decomposition-based archiving pruning strategy into particle swarm optimiser for many-objective optimisation problems. The innovations of the proposed algorithm mainly contains three crucial factors: (1) A bi-level archiving maintenance approach based on the R2 indicator and objective space decomposition strategy is designed to balance convergence and diversity. (2) The global-best leader selection is based on the R2 indicator and the personal-best leader selection is based on the Pareto dominance. Meanwhile, the objective space decomposition leader selection adopts the feedback information from the bi-level archive. (3) A new velocity updated method is modified to enhance the exploration and exploitation ability. In addition, an elitist learning strategy and a smart Gaussian learning strategy are embedded into R2-MaPSO to help the algorithm jump out of the local optimal front. The performance of the proposed algorithm is validated and compared with some algorithms on a number of unconstraint benchmark problems, i.e. DTLZ1-DTLZ4, WFG test suites from 3 to 15 objectives. Experimental results have demonstrated a better performance of the proposed algorithm compared with several multi-objective particle swarm optimisers and multi-objective evolutionary algorithms for many-objective optimisation problems.  相似文献   

2.
提出一种求解柔性作业车间成组调度FGJSS(flexible grouped job-shop scheduling)问题的蚁群粒子群求解算法。算法采用主从递阶形式,主级为蚁群优化算法,选择零件加工设备;从级为粒子群优化算法,在主级零件加工设备约束下优化设备作业排序以实现流通时间最小的目标。算法中,以工序加工时间和设备承载的作业族数为启发式信息设计蚂蚁在工序可用设备间转移概率;以粒子向量优先权值和作业族号为依据设计解码方法实现设备上的成组作业排序。最后,通过仿真实验,验证了该算法的有效性。  相似文献   

3.
Information about the three-dimensional structure or function of a newly determined protein sequence can be obtained if the protein is found to contain a characterized motif or pattern of residues. Recently a database (PROSITE) has been established that contains 337 known motifs encoded as a list of allowed residue types at specific positions along the sequence. PROMOT is a FORTRAN computer program that takes a protein sequence and examines if it contains any of the motifs in PROSITE. The program also extends the definitions of patterns beyond those used in PROSITE to provide a simple, yet flexible, method to scan either a PROSITE or a user-defined pattern against a protein sequence database.  相似文献   

4.
Abstract

Concerning the drawbacks that particle swarm optimisation algorithm is easy to fall into the local optima, and has low solution precision, the simplified particle algorithm which based on the nonlinear decrease extreme disturbance and Cauchy mutation is proposed. The algorithm simplifies particle updating formula, and uses logistic chaotic sequence to initialise the particle position, which can improve the global search ability of population; nonlinear decrease extreme disturbance strategy enhanced the diversity of the population and avoid the particles trapping in local optimum; a novel Cauchy mutation is used for the optimal particle variation to generate more optimal guiding particle movement. The experimental simulation on seven typical test functions shows that the proposed algorithm can effectively avoid falling into local optimal solution, the search speed and optimisation accuracy have improved significantly. The algorithm is suitable to solve the function optimisation problem.  相似文献   

5.
Integration of process planning and scheduling (IPPS) is an important research issue to achieve manufacturing planning optimisation. In both process planning and scheduling, vast search spaces and complex technical constraints are significant barriers to the effectiveness of the processes. In this paper, the IPPS problem has been developed as a combinatorial optimisation model, and a modern evolutionary algorithm, i.e., the particle swarm optimisation (PSO) algorithm, has been modified and applied to solve it effectively. Initial solutions are formed and encoded into particles of the PSO algorithm. The particles “fly” intelligently in the search space to achieve the best sequence according to the optimisation strategies of the PSO algorithm. Meanwhile, to explore the search space comprehensively and to avoid being trapped into local optima, several new operators have been developed to improve the particles’ movements to form a modified PSO algorithm. Case studies have been conducted to verify the performance and efficiency of the modified PSO algorithm. A comparison has been made between the result of the modified PSO algorithm and the previous results generated by the genetic algorithm (GA) and the simulated annealing (SA) algorithm, respectively, and the different characteristics of the three algorithms are indicated. Case studies show that the developed PSO can generate satisfactory results in both applications.  相似文献   

6.
惯性权重是粒子群算法中平衡全局搜索和局部搜索能力的重要参数,提出了一种基于改进惯性权重的粒子群优化算法。该算法在进化初期采用基于不同粒子不同维的动态自适应惯性权重策略,加快收敛速度,在进化后期采用线性递减权重策略,同时为防止陷入局优,适时引入混沌变异增加种群多样性。对5个典型测试函数的测试结果表明,NPSO在收敛速度、收敛精度、稳定性和全局搜索能力等方面比线性权重PSO(LDIWPSO)均有很大程度上的提高。  相似文献   

7.
Inertia weight is one of the control parameters that influences the performance of particle swarm optimisation (PSO) in the course of solving global optimisation problems, by striking a balance between exploration and exploitation. Among many inertia weight strategies that have been proposed in literature are chaotic descending inertia weight (CDIW) and chaotic random inertia weight (CRIW). These two strategies have been claimed to perform better than linear descending inertia weight (LDIW) and random inertia weight (RIW). Despite these successes, a closer look at their results reveals that the common problem of premature convergence associated with PSO algorithm still lingers. Motivated by the better performances of CDIW and CRIW, this paper proposed two new inertia weight strategies namely: swarm success rate descending inertia weight (SSRDIW) and swarm success rate random inertia weight (SSRRIW). These two strategies use swarm success rates as a feedback parameter. Efforts were made using the proposed inertia weight strategies with PSO to further improve the effectiveness of the algorithm in terms of convergence speed, global search ability and improved solution accuracy. The proposed PSO variants, SSRDIWPSO and SSRRIWPSO were validated using several benchmark unconstrained global optimisation test problems and their performances compared with LDIW-PSO, CDIW-PSO, RIW-PSO, CRIW-PSO and some other existing PSO variants. Empirical results showed that the proposed variants are more efficient.  相似文献   

8.
网格工作流调度关注大规模的资源和任务调度,是一个复杂且具有挑战性的问题,它影响着网格工作流执行成功与否以及效率的高低。提出了基于遗传粒子群(GAPSO)的混合算法,引用了特殊的适应度函数,设定了动态的交叉和变异概率,并提出了动态切换算法的方法。结合各自算法的优势,在算法运行初期利用遗传算法的全局搜索能力进行优化搜索,在后期利用粒子群较强的局部搜索能力加快收敛速度。仿真结果表明该算法在执行时间方面有一定的优越性,能更有效地解决网格工作流调度问题。  相似文献   

9.
基于寿命的粒子群算法研究   总被引:1,自引:0,他引:1  
针对粒子群算法易陷入局部最优的缺陷,提出了一种具有寿命的PSO(LS-PSO),算法赋予gbest有限的寿命,并且根据其引导能力对寿命进行自适应调整。当gbest耗尽其寿命时,它将失去领导能力,并被一个新产生并经测试具有足够引导能力的粒子所代替,继续引导群体搜索解空间的不同区域,并在两个单峰标准测试函数和六个多峰标准测试函数上对算法进行了测试。结果表明,LS-PSO比传统PSO及改进算法CLPSO有更好的求解精度和收敛速度。  相似文献   

10.
Optimisation of looped water distribution networks (WDNs) has been recognised as an NP-hard combinatorial problem which cannot be easily solved using traditional mathematical optimisation techniques. This article proposes the use of a new version of heuristic particle swarm optimisation (PSO) for solving this problem. In order to increase the convergence speed of the original PSO algorithm, some accelerated parameters are introduced to the velocity update equation. Furthermore, momentum parts are added to the PSO position updating formula to get away from trapping in local optimums. The new version of the PSO algorithm is called accelerated momentum particle swarm optimisation (AMPSO). The proposed AMPSO is then applied to solve WDN design problems. Some illustrative and comparative illustrative examples are presented to show the efficiency of the introduced AMPSO compared with some other heuristic algorithms.  相似文献   

11.
This article introduces a recurrent fuzzy neural network based on improved particle swarm optimisation (IPSO) for non-linear system control. An IPSO method which consists of the modified evolutionary direction operator (MEDO) and the Particle Swarm Optimisation (PSO) is proposed in this article. A MEDO combining the evolutionary direction operator and the migration operation is also proposed. The MEDO will improve the global search solution. Experimental results have shown that the proposed IPSO method controls the magnetic levitation system and the planetary train type inverted pendulum system better than the traditional PSO and the genetic algorithm methods.  相似文献   

12.
Many real-world optimisation problems are both dynamic and multi-modal, which require an optimisation algorithm not only to find as many optima under a specific environment as possible, but also to track their moving trajectory over dynamic environments. To address this requirement, this article investigates a memetic computing approach based on particle swarm optimisation for dynamic multi-modal optimisation problems (DMMOPs). Within the framework of the proposed algorithm, a new speciation method is employed to locate and track multiple peaks and an adaptive local search method is also hybridised to accelerate the exploitation of species generated by the speciation method. In addition, a memory-based re-initialisation scheme is introduced into the proposed algorithm in order to further enhance its performance in dynamic multi-modal environments. Based on the moving peaks benchmark problems, experiments are carried out to investigate the performance of the proposed algorithm in comparison with several state-of-the-art algorithms taken from the literature. The experimental results show the efficiency of the proposed algorithm for DMMOPs.  相似文献   

13.
Seeker optimisation algorithm (SOA), also referred to as human group metaheuristic optimisation algorithms form a very hot area of research, is an emerging population-based and gradient-free optimisation tool. It is inspired by searching behaviour of human beings in finding an optimal solution. The principal shortcoming of SOA is that it is easily trapped in local optima and consequently fails to achieve near-global solutions in complex optimisation problems. In an attempt to relieve this problem, in this article, chaos-based strategies are embedded into SOA. Five various chaotic-based SOA strategies with four different chaotic map functions are examined and the best strategy is chosen as the suitable chaotic scheme for SOA. The results of applying the proposed chaotic SOA to miscellaneous benchmark functions confirm that it provides accurate solutions. It surpasses basic SOA, genetic algorithm, gravitational search algorithm variant, cuckoo search optimisation algorithm, firefly swarm optimisation and harmony search the proposed chaos-based SOA is expected successfully solve complex engineering optimisation problems.  相似文献   

14.
The evolutionary optimisation algorithms appeared as an effective alternative to conventional statistical methods that have certain limitations in optimising complex manufacturing processes. Considering works published in the last decade, this paper presents an analysis of the particle swarm optimisation (PSO) implementation in designing parameters of heterogeneous manufacturing processes, both conventional and emerging, new processes. The literature review and analysis was structured according to the complexity of the optimisation problem (single response and multiresponse problems), and the development of an objective function for PSO. The tuning of the PSO algorithm-specific parameters was analysed in detail. The PSO algorithm performance was benchmarked with the results of other methods, including evolutionary algorithms, in designing process parameters. The concerns in applying PSO for multiresponse manufacturing problems were highlighted, and recommendations for future research were drawn. Such a comprehensive review on the PSO application in optimising manufacturing processes, including the detailed discussion on the algorithm characteristics and benchmark with other optimisation procedures, has not been pursued so far. Therefore, this review analysis provides hands on information for researchers and engineers at one place, and it is believed that the findings could serve as a basis for the future research and implementation directions.  相似文献   

15.
Particle swarm optimisation (PSO) is a well-established optimisation algorithm inspired from flocking behaviour of birds. The big problem in PSO is that it suffers from premature convergence, that is, in complex optimisation problems, it may easily get trapped in local optima. In this paper, a new PSO variant, named as enhanced leader PSO (ELPSO), is proposed for mitigating premature convergence problem. ELPSO is mainly based on a five-staged successive mutation strategy which is applied to swarm leader at each iteration. The experimental results confirm that in all terms of accuracy, scalability and convergence rate, ELPSO performs well.  相似文献   

16.
Bat swarm optimisation (BSO) is a novel heuristic optimisation algorithm that is being used for solving different global optimisation problems. The paramount problem in BSO is that it severely suffers from premature convergence problem, that is, BSO is easily trapped in local optima. In this paper, chaotic-based strategies are incorporated into BSO to mitigate this problem. Ergodicity and non-repetitious nature of chaotic functions can diversify the bats and mitigate premature convergence problem. Eleven different chaotic map functions along with various chaotic BSO strategies are investigated experimentally and the best one is chosen as the suitable chaotic strategy for BSO. The results of applying the proposed chaotic BSO to different benchmark functions vividly show that premature convergence problem has been mitigated efficiently. Actually, chaotic-based BSO significantly outperforms conventional BSO, cuckoo search optimisation (CSO), big bang-big crunch algorithm (BBBC), gravitational search algorithm (GSA) and genetic algorithm (GA).  相似文献   

17.
In recent years, Pareto-based selection mechanism has been successfully applied in dealing with complex multi-objective optimisation problems (MOPs), while indicators-based have been explored to apply in solving this problems. Therefore, a new multi-objective particle swarm optimisation algorithm based on R2 indicator selection mechanism (R2SMMOPSO) is presented in this paper. In the proposed algorithm, R2 indicator is designed as a selection mechanism for ensuring convergence and distribution of the algorithm simultaneously. In addition, an improved cosine-adjusted inertia weight balances the ability of algorithm exploitation and exploration effectively. Besides, Gaussian mutation strategy is designed to prevent particles from falling into the local optimum when the particle does not satisfy the condition of the position update formula, polynomial mutation is applied in the external archive to increase the diversity of elite solutions. The performance of the proposed algorithm is validated and compared with some state-of-the-art algorithms on a number of test problems. Experimental studies demonstrate that the proposed algorithm shows very competitive performance when dealing with complex MOPs.  相似文献   

18.
在研究标准粒子群算法和遗传算法的基础上,介绍一种加入遗传选择,交叉算子以及变异算子的扩展算法,以提高粒子群算法摆脱局部极值点的能力,并且算法具有较快的收敛能力。  相似文献   

19.
In this paper, we address markerless full-body articulated human motion tracking from multi-view video sequences acquired in a studio environment. The tracking is formulated as a multi-dimensional non-linear optimisation and solved using particle swarm optimisation (PSO), a swarm-intelligence algorithm which has gained popularity in recent years due to its ability to solve difficult non-linear optimisation problems. We show that a small number of particles achieves accuracy levels comparable with several recent algorithms. PSO initialises automatically, does not need a sequence-specific motion model and recovers from temporary tracking divergence through the use of a powerful hierarchical search algorithm (HPSO). We compare experimentally HPSO with particle filter (PF), annealed particle filter (APF) and partitioned sampling annealed particle filter (PSAPF) using the computational framework provided by Balan et al. HPSO accuracy and consistency are better than PF and compare favourably with those of APF and PSAPF, outperforming it in sequences with sudden and fast motion. We also report an extensive experimental study of HPSO over ranges of values of its parameters.  相似文献   

20.
This paper proposes an enhanced support vector machine (SVM), whose parameters are optimised by a novel mutant particle swarm optimisation (mutant PSO) algorithm to identify metal-oxide surge arrester conditions. The total leakage current and its resistive component under different arrester conditions are obtained and then are inputted into a multilayer SVM for the purpose of fault identification. Then, a mutant PSO-based technique is investigated to increase the classification accuracy as well as the training speed of the SVM classifier. The proposed technique has been tested on an actual data set obtained from Taipower Company to monitor five arrester operating conditions, including normal (N), pre-fault (A), tracking (T), abnormal (U) and degradation (D). Furthermore, to demonstrate the effectiveness of the proposed mutant PSO, the obtained results are compared to those obtained by using cross-validation method, genetic algorithm and particle swarm optimisation.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号